What Happens When Your eSIM Data Runs Out?

Travelesim Editorial4 min read

Usually your data simply stops. Here is how top-ups work and what to do if you cannot buy more immediately.

Airplane window view

On most fixed-data travel eSIMs, reaching the cap means mobile data stops or slows dramatically. It does not usually delete the eSIM profile, and it does not automatically charge you for more data unless you buy a top-up.

What to do next

  • Top up in the same app if a top-up exists for your plan
  • Buy a new short plan from the same or another provider
  • Fall back to café and hotel Wi‑Fi until you sort it
